Mid-Autumn Festival, also called Mid-Autumn Festival, is a traditional festival in China. It falls on 15 of the eighth month of the lunar calendar, usually in September or early October according to the Gregorian calendar. This festival has a history of more than 3,000 years, and many countries in Asia celebrate it.

On this special day, families get together to enjoy a pleasant feast. Moon cake is a traditional cake with lotus seed paste and salted egg yolk, which is a necessary food for Mid-Autumn Festival. People think that sharing moon cakes symbolizes unity and reunion. ?
In addition to enjoying delicious food, every household will light colorful lanterns and put them in the garden or by the river to create a charming scene in the bright moonlight.

One of the most important customs of Mid-Autumn Festival is to enjoy the moon. Family and friends sit outdoors, enjoying the full moon while drinking tea and sharing stories. ?
In China culture, the round and bright moon is a symbol of reunion, happiness and harmony. Folklores and poems are often shared, adding a touch of cultural richness to the atmosphere.

Children especially like Mid-Autumn Festival, because they can play with bright lanterns and solve riddles on the lanterns. For them, this is a happy time full of laughter and excitement. ?
Traditionally, Mid-Autumn Festival is also a time to express good wishes. People exchange greetings, such as "Happy Mid-Autumn Festival" (ZH, meaning "Happy Mid-Autumn Festival"), and share their hopes for a better future.
